Abstract
The development of Virtual Reality (VR) technology opens up new opportunities to create exciting gameplay experiences while encouraging players to be more physically active. This study aims to design a VR-based game called Moving Score, focusing on the development of motion-based interaction systems and the implementation of responsive game mechanics. The game was developed using Unity and the XR Interaction Toolkit, featuring various elements such as a dynamic scoring system, visual and audio feedback, and real-time motion detection. The method used is prototyping, starting from needs identification, prototype development, to testing and iteration. The final results show that the game successfully delivers intuitive interaction, provides effective feedback, and enhances user engagement in a virtual environment. Moving Score not only offers entertainment but also holds potential as an educational medium that supports users' physical activity and movement coordination.
